What Is A Ring Of Fire Annular Solar Eclipse NASA Explains

NASA explains how a 'ring of fire' annular solar eclipse occurs and how it differs from a total solar eclipse.
WARNING: People should always use protective solar eclipse eyewear when viewing a solar eclipse.

Roughly every year or two, somewhere in the world, the sun appears for a few moments as a ring of fire in the sky.
00:08
This is called an annular solar eclipse.
00:11
Annular comes from the Latin word annulus, which means ring.
00:15
An annular solar eclipse occurs when a new moon passes directly in front of the sun but appears too small to cover it completely.
00:23
But why is that?
00:24
It's because the moon's orbit around Earth isn't a perfect circle, but rather an ellipse, or slightly oval-shaped.
00:31
This causes the moon to move closer to us and then farther away during its month-long orbit.
00:36
When the moon is at its closest point, called perigee, it appears slightly larger in our sky.
00:42
When it's farthest from us, at apogee, it appears a little smaller.
00:47
But we don't see an annular eclipse every month.
00:51
That's because the moon's orbit is also slightly tilted in relation to Earth's orbit around the sun.
00:57
This means during most months the moon is either too high or too low to block the sun.
01:02
So only when a new moon is at apogee and passes directly between Earth and the sun
01:07
do spectators on Earth get the rare opportunity to see the ring of fire in the sky.
01:13
Unlike a total solar eclipse, when the moon completely covers the sun,
01:17
during an annular eclipse, the sun never fully disappears.
01:21
So if you're lucky enough to be in the path of an annular solar eclipse,
01:25
make sure to wear your solar eclipse glasses or use other safe solar filters
01:29
to witness this spectacular ring of fire in the sky.
